Pick PETG-CF if:
- you are ready to dry the spool before printing
- your printer has a hardened nozzle
Pick PLA-CF if:
- you want it to print on any printer — nozzle up to 230 °C, lower than PETG-CF
- a plain bed is enough — it only needs 40 °C
- no drying needed before printing
- your printer has a hardened nozzle
